Deconstructing the Visual Appeal and Practicality

The personality of the Easter Line Tracing Coloring | No-Prep collection is one of approachable charm and clarity. The visual style hinges on simple, bold line art that is immediately recognizable and easy to engage with. There’s a deliberate lack of intricate detail, which serves two critical purposes. First, it ensures the primary function—tracing—is successful for small hands developing fine motor control. Second, from a design perspective, this simplicity translates to incredible versatility. The bold outlines hold their own at various scales, from a full-page print to a small social media icon, without becoming muddy or lost. The monochromatic, black-and-white format is a significant strength, eliminating color ink concerns for users and providing a neutral, clean canvas for designers. This allows the Easter-themed illustrations to be used as-is, or easily colored, textured, or integrated into a specific brand color palette without clashing.

As a digital file package, its practicality is immediately apparent. The inclusion of both PDF and high-resolution JPEG files at a standard 8.5x11 inch dimension means it’s print-ready for the most common home and office printers. For the entrepreneur or crafter, this removes the technical barrier of resizing or reformatting. You download, you print, you use. This "print and go" ethos is a core part of its appeal, respecting the time constraints of busy professionals, whether they are preschool teachers, homeschool parents, or marketing managers looking for quick, thematic content.

Making It Work: Practical Guidance for Professionals

Integrating an asset like this requires a strategic eye. First, always evaluate the project fit. The playful, hand-drawn style of the Easter Line Tracing Coloring | No-Prep pack is ideal for projects targeting families, educators, or conveying a sense of warmth and nostalgia. It would be less suitable for a corporate law firm’s annual report, where a formal serif font and structured imagery are expected.

When using the illustrations in a design, pay close attention to readability and visual hierarchy. If you’re overlaying text, ensure there is sufficient contrast. You might place the illustration at a low opacity behind your headline, or use it as a standalone icon in the margin. Pairing it with the right typeface is crucial. A clean, friendly sans serif font like Lato or Open Sans will complement its approachable nature. For a more whimsical, storybook feel, a legible script font or handwritten font could work for headlines, but use it sparingly to avoid compromising legibility in body text.
